Overview
Millisecond precision timing chips are specialized integrated circuits designed to deliver highly accurate timing signals with minimal deviation, typically within 1 millisecond. These chips are widely used in industries where precise synchronization is critical, such as telecommunications, aerospace, and industrial automation. Their compact size and low power consumption make them ideal for integration into various electronic systems. Unlike standard timing chips, millisecond precision variants incorporate advanced algorithms and high-quality oscillators to minimize timing errors. They are often used in network synchronization, data logging, and real-time control systems. The demand for these chips has grown with the expansion of IoT and smart infrastructure projects.
Structure and Working Principle
The millisecond precision timing chip typically consists of a crystal oscillator, a phase-locked loop (PLL), and a microcontroller unit (MCU). The crystal oscillator generates a stable frequency, which is then fine-tuned by the PLL to achieve the desired timing accuracy. The MCU processes the signal and outputs it in a format suitable for the target application. These chips often include built-in error correction mechanisms to compensate for environmental factors such as temperature fluctuations. Some advanced models also feature GPS synchronization capabilities, further enhancing their accuracy. The working principle revolves around maintaining a consistent and reliable timing reference, ensuring that all connected systems operate in perfect harmony.
Key Features
One of the standout features of millisecond precision timing chips is their exceptional accuracy, often achieving deviations of less than 1 millisecond. This makes them indispensable for applications like 5G networks, where timing synchronization is crucial for seamless communication. Additionally, these chips are designed for low power consumption, making them suitable for battery-operated devices. Another notable feature is their compact form factor, which allows for easy integration into space-constrained designs. Many models also offer programmable output frequencies, providing flexibility for various applications. Robust error-handling mechanisms ensure reliable performance even in challenging environments.
Application Areas
Millisecond precision timing chips are widely used in telecommunications to synchronize base stations and ensure smooth data transmission. In aerospace, they play a critical role in navigation systems and flight control units. Industrial automation systems rely on these chips for precise coordination of machinery and processes. The Internet of Things (IoT) is another major application area, where these chips help synchronize data collection and transmission across distributed sensors. They are also used in smart grids to maintain synchronization between different parts of the power distribution network. The versatility of these chips makes them a key component in modern technology infrastructure.
Maintenance and Precautions
To ensure optimal performance, millisecond precision timing chips should be handled with care to avoid electrostatic discharge (ESD) damage. Proper grounding techniques should be employed during installation and maintenance. These chips should also be protected from extreme temperatures and humidity, which can affect their accuracy. Regular firmware updates may be required for programmable models to maintain compatibility with evolving system requirements. It's also advisable to periodically check the synchronization accuracy using specialized testing equipment. Proper storage conditions, such as anti-static packaging and controlled environments, can extend the lifespan of these components.
